About Ramp

Ramp is a privately held New York financial-services company founded in 2019. Its platform combines corporate cards, spend and expense management, bill payments, accounting automation, procurement, travel, treasury, and other financial-operations services. Ramp reports serving more than 70,000 companies.

About the Role

Own the technical roadmap for underwriting, limit management, portfolio optimization, and agentic workflows. Architect scalable stateful systems, build real-time credit decisioning and risk controls, automate credit decisions, and partner with analysts, data scientists, and product partners to translate risk strategies into reliable software.

Requirements

  • 2+ years of backend engineering experience.
  • Proficiency in Python or a comparable backend language.
  • Experience with distributed systems and async frameworks.
  • Ability to convert abstract business problems into robust data models and technical specifications.
  • Experience building or operating systems with strict auditability, observability, and correctness guarantees.
  • Ability to work closely with non-engineering partners in Risk Strategy, Operations, and Sales.

Responsibilities

  • Architect scalable, stateful systems for automated limit management.
  • Build agents and tools that automate manual credit decisions and improve operational efficiency.
  • Develop high-volume, low-latency risk controls for new products, customer segments, and geographies.
  • Design and build real-time decisioning systems across the credit lifecycle.
  • Partner with analysts, data scientists, and product partners to translate risk strategies into reliable software.
